Price for Stainless Steel in Ingots or Other Primary Forms in Bangladesh (CIF) - 2022
In 2022, the average import price for stainless steel in ingots or other primary forms amounted to $2,099 per ton, remaining relatively unchanged against the previous year. Over the period under review, import price indicated a moderate expansion from 2012 to 2022: its price increased at an average annual rate of +2.9%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, import price for stainless steel in ingots or other primary forms decreased by -0.9% against 2020 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2015 when the average import price increased by 31%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$2,119 per ton in 2020; afterwards, it flattened through to 2022.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was China ($13,491 per ton), while the price for South Korea ($506 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by China (+22.2%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Imports of Stainless Steel in Ingots or Other Primary Forms in Bangladesh
After three years of growth, supplies from abroad of stainless steel in ingots or other primary forms decreased by -3.7% to 24 tons in 2022. Over the period under review, total imports indicated a buoyant increase from 2019 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+16.5%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, imports increased by +58.2% against 2019 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 with an increase of 52%.
In value terms, imports of stainless steel in ingots or other primary forms fell slightly to $50K in 2022. Overall, total imports indicated significant growth from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+25.3%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, imports increased by +96.7% against 2019 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 with an increase of 91% against the previous year.
